Output 396e514d0f305f7a256dc60de07b33ceefc232bd92bdd05138c0433754a85260:0

value
1840000
script pubkey
OP_0 OP_PUSHBYTES_20 fc04e4f6e588cc81db75d39859e3890bb146b6cb
address
bc1qlszwfah93rxgrkm46wv9ncufpwc5ddktsesjmw
transaction
396e514d0f305f7a256dc60de07b33ceefc232bd92bdd05138c0433754a85260
confirmations
158919
spent
true